实验目的

应用所学知识:

①理解交换机通过逆向自学习算法建立地址转发表的过程

②理解交换机转发数据帧的规则

③理解交换机的工作原理

实验步骤与结果

1.任务一:准备工作

①拓扑训练

打开实验文件可以看到交换机工作原理的的拓扑结构图:

图中交换机指示灯均呈绿色,且右下角暗红图标变为successful,删除场景,初始化完成:

②删除交换机地址转发表

通过如下命令行语句删除Switch0\1\2的地址转发表:

2.任务二:观察交换机的工作原理

①查看并记录PC0和PC2的MAC地址

从Config选项卡中获取到PC0和PC2的MAC地址分别为00E0.F966.5625和00D0.BCE9.C0B8:

②添加PC0到PC2的数据包

③分别查看三台交换机在发送数据前的地址转发表

④查看Switch0的学习和转发过程

发包后再查看Switch0的MAC地址转发表可以发现在FastEthernet0/3端口增加了PC0的MAC地址00E0.F966.5625:

并且由拓补图的动画可知,Switch0将源端主机PC0发送的数据包洪泛转发给了其他交换机。

同样,查看Switch1的地址转发表:

以及Switch2的地址转发表:

⑤观察Switch1和Switch2的学习和转发过程

3.思考题

(1)观察结果表

发送的帧

Switch0的转发表

Switch1的转发表

Switch2的转发表

Switch0的处理

Switch1的处理

Switch2的处理

地址

接口

地址

接口

地址

接口

PC0→PC2

00E0.F966.5625

FastEthernet0/1

00E0.F966.5625

FastEthernet0/1

00E0.F966.5625

FastEthernet0/1

洪泛

洪泛

洪泛

PC1→PC0

00D0.BA0E.6EC7

FastEthernet0/3

00D0.BA0E.6EC7

FastEthernet0/3

————

————

转发

转发

——

PC1→PC0

————

————

00D0.BA0E.6EC7

FastEthernet0/3

00D0.BA0E.6EC7

FastEthernet0/1

转发

洪泛

丢弃

(2)增加了一项PC0的MAC地址,因为转发表里没有PC0对应的表项,交换机自动学习。

(3)洪泛,因为Switch1的转发表中没有PC2的地址,所以只能通过洪泛转发的形式尝试找到PC2。

(4)删除前无事发生,删除后会将数据包丢弃。

【计算机网络】交换机工作原理相关推荐

  1. 计算机网络 交换机工作原理

    交换机工作原理 数据通过网卡发送出去之前,必须在各层封装完成. 主机I向主机IV发送消息过程 主机I在各层上的数据都封装完毕,唯独在数据链路层没有目的主机的MAC地址,所以主机I会发送一个ARP广播. ...

  2. 计算机网络交换机原理,计算机网络__交换机工作原理

    计算机网络交换机工作原理 在前面了解到根据交换机在OSI参考模型中工作的协议层不同,将交换机分为二层交换机.三层交换机.四层交换机.交换机工作的协议层不同,其工作原理也不相同.下面我们将介绍各层交换机 ...

  3. 交换机工作原理_什么是POE交换机,它有什么好处?

    一.相信大家都听说过交换机,但是POE交换机大家可能有点陌生,接下来给大家重点讲解下,什么是POE交换机,它有什么好处.POE也被称为基于局域网的供电系统(POL, Power over LAN )或 ...

  4. 网络基础笔记(三)二层交换机工作原理、单点故障与链路聚合、DHCP

    目录   0x01 二层交换机工作原理   0x02 二层交换机单点故障如何解决   0x03 链路聚合   0x04 DHCP 0x01 二层交换机工作原理 二层交换机MAC表的限制 1.交换机MA ...

  5. eNSP第三篇:STP,生成树,xSTP,MSTP,多生成树,交换机工作原理,环路的形成

    STP,生成树,xSTP,MSTP,多生成树,交换机工作原理,环路的形成 了解环路的形成 交换机的工作原理 交换机接口在接收到数据包时,会检查数据包的源MAC地址和目的MAC地址,然后查询MAC地址表 ...

  6. 6.OSI七层模型及交换机工作原理及VLAN(虚拟局域网)及VTP(vlan同步技术)

    交换机工作原理及VLAN(虚拟局域网) ❤OSI参考模型:从下往上,第一层是物理层 物理层:在设备之间传输比特流(以010101这样的二进制进行传输,以电信号的形式进行传输,0没有,1有) 物理层给线 ...

  7. 交换机:简述对交换机工作原理的认识

    一.交换机工作原理 交换机在接收到数据帧以后,首先.会记录数据帧中的源MAC地址和对应的接口到MAC表中,接着.会检查自己的MAC表中是否有数据帧中目标MAC地址的信息,如果有则会根据MAC表中记录的 ...

  8. 交换机工作原理/模式

    一.交换机工作原理 交换机中有一个MAC地址表,对应着计算机的MAC地址和交换机相连的端口号 1.MAC地址学习 例如 主机A去找主机B,交换机首先查询MAC地址表中1接口对应的源MAC条目.如果条目 ...

  9. 交换机原理_交换机工作原理解析

    原文连接:http://www.elecfans.com/dianzichangshi/20171204593673.html 交换机原理 数据传输基于OSI七层模型,而交换机就工作于其第二层,即数据 ...

最新文章

  1. div根据内容改变大小并且左右居中
  2. 自动化机器学习(三)神经网络架构搜索综述(NAS)简述
  3. 【转】jmeter学习笔记——JDBC测试计划-连接Mysql
  4. 电脑键盘练习_电脑新手最关心的:零基础如何快速掌握电脑打字的技巧?
  5. C#LeetCode刷题之#237-删除链表中的节点(Delete Node in a Linked List)
  6. Hadoop单点安装(伪分布式)
  7. 动态规划——买卖股票的最好时机(Leetcode 121)
  8. John the Ripper 密码破解者
  9. 如何查看linux中的ssh端口开启状态
  10. 整流五 - PWM整流器无差拍控制 一(重复控制算法)
  11. Dos窗口的常见打开方式和常见命令
  12. Ctrl 键失效或者 Ctrl + D键失效,不灵
  13. Python爬虫圈最能打的专栏教程,《Python爬虫120例》教程导航帖(2023.2.6更新)
  14. 如何根据PPI网络进一步挖掘信息
  15. 云ERP有什么优势?功能有哪些?
  16. 【计算机网络】数据通信技术基础(数据通信性能指标、传输介质、数据交换技术、差错控制技术)
  17. 移动应用开发期末总结
  18. SNMP 协议RFC
  19. 赶紧自查,你的身份证很有可能被别人绑定了!
  20. VSO Downloader 【您连接到互联网的网络适配器没有启动自动检测 】解决办法

热门文章

  1. 利用js去除发货100广告
  2. leetcode之大顶堆和小顶堆
  3. 基于Unity的多人协作游戏开发
  4. C#学习之音乐播放器
  5. Unity--升级Android api level 28踩坑记录
  6. celebA标签错误celebA标签错误celebA标签错误
  7. IOS学习之道:使用UIButton纯手工打造的黑白快小游戏.
  8. ICLR 2021 有什么值得关注的投稿?
  9. xshell转MobaXterm
  10. 在线免费角色动画网站:mixamo